Jean-Claude Passeron

Jean-Claude Passeron (born 26 November 1930) is a French sociologist and leader of social science studies.

As part of a mixed interdisciplinary team involving sociologists, historians, and anthropologists, he led the magazine Enquêtes.

In Paris, Jean-Claude Passeron studied philosophy and sociology at École Normale Supérieure.

In 1968, he was part of the group which founded le Centre Universitaire Expérimental de Vincennes, an avant-garde pedagogic project that today has become l'Université Paris VIII.

He also worked with Jean-Claude Chamboredon, Robert Castel, Claude Grignon, Michel Grumbach and François de Singly.
